Description
Description Responsible for the installation and maintenance of electrical and instrument process measurement and control systems throughout the facility while meeting safety, security, production, quality, and environmental requirements. Job Responsibilities Troubleshoot and repair control circuits, low voltage electrical circuits, and control loops, including level, pressure, temperature, flow, pH, and conductivity. Disassemble malfunctioning instruments, examine and test mechanics and circuitry for defects, and reassemble instruments according to manufacturer specifications. Inspect and calibrate instruments periodically. Install, adjust, and repair control mechanisms, such as positioners, to ensure equipment functions properly. Moderate to high physical exertion – up to 85% of time spent walking, standing, climbing, bending, or stooping. Work is done in elevated as well as confined spaces. This position reports to the I&E Maintenance Supervisor. Requirements Education & Experience 1-3 years of experience as a journeyman and completion of approved apprenticeship program relative to skill. Reading, writing and math skills comparable to a high school education. Experience with programmable logic controllers (PLCs) and distributed controls is preferred. Schedule: Monday-Friday day shift, plus overtime and callouts as required to support production. The salary is $31.23 - $37.76/hour DOE plus excellent benefits commencing on date of hire, including healthcare, PTO leave, vacation, and 10 paid holidays/year.
